What Are Robot Sweepers?
Robot sweepers, frequently referred to as robotic vacuum, are self-governing devices developed to clean floors with minimal human intervention. Geared up with numerous sensors, brushes, and suction capabilities, these smart gadgets browse through living areas, selecting up dust, dirt, and debris effectively. They can be found in different sizes and shapes, dealing with different cleaning requirements and floor types.
Key Features of Robot Sweepers
Smart Navigation Systems:
- Many robot sweepers utilize innovative navigation systems such as LIDAR or camera-based mapping to develop a detailed map of the area they clean. These systems assist them navigate effectively and avoid challenges.
Arranged Cleaning:
- Users can often program robot sweepers to run at particular times, making it simple to maintain a clean home without manual intervention.
Sensing units and Detectors:
- Robot sweepers are geared up with sensors that allow them to detect dirtier areas and adjust their cleaning intensity appropriately. Some models can even determine stairs and ledges to prevent falling.
Compatibility with Smart Home Systems:
- Many robot sweepers can perfectly integrate with smart home environments, making it possible for voice command functionalities and remote control via smart device apps.

How Robot Sweepers Work
Comprehending the inner operations of robot sweepers can shed light on why they are so reliable. Here's a streamlined overview of the process:
- Mapping: The robot sweeper begins by scanning the environment to draw up the area using laser sensors or cameras.
- Navigation: Once the area is mapped, the robot makes use of the information to browse efficiently, cleaning partial areas before carrying on to others.
- Cleaning: Equipped with brushes and suction systems, the robot sweeper collects debris and dirt from floorings.
- Returning Home: Upon completing its task or when the battery is low, the robotic vacuum automatically goes back to its charging dock.
Frequently Asked Questions About Robot Sweepers
1. Can robot sweepers change conventional vacuum cleaners?
- While robot sweepers are excellent for keeping tidiness and dealing with light dirt, they might not completely change traditional vacuums for deep cleaning jobs.
2. How frequently should Robot Vacuum Cleaner run my robot sweeper?
- It is advisable to run robot sweepers at least two times a week, depending upon foot traffic in your home.
3. Are robot sweepers ideal for family pet owners?
- Yes, many models are specifically developed for animal hair elimination and function specialized brushes and powerful suction options.
4. Do robot sweepers deal with carpets?
- A lot of robot sweepers can clean carpets successfully, but suction power and brush design may differ. High-end models frequently have settings to adjust to carpeted surface areas.
5. How much do robot sweepers cost?
- Costs differ based on features and brands, varying from about ₤ 200 for budget options to over ₤ 900 for high-end designs with advanced capabilities.
